AIM: To quantify the risk of dorsal innervation injury when performing direct metacarpophalangeal joint portals of the second to fifth fingers. MATERIAL AND METHOD: An anatomical study of 11 upper limbs of fresh corpses was carried out. After placing them in a traction tower, the metacarpophalangeal portals were developed on both sides of the extensor tendon. The dorsal sensory branches were dissected and the distances between the portal and the nearest nerve were measured by a digital caliper. The portals of all the fingers were compared globally to assess the safest finger and two to two radial and ulnar portals were compared in each of the fingers to assess the safest portal within each finger. RESULTS: The overall comparison of all portals and fingers showed that the third finger is the safest in any of its portals, while the ulnar side of the second and radial of the fourth are the portals with the highest risk of nerve injury (P=8.96·10-5). Comparing two to two of the radial and ulnar portals in each of the fingers showed that the ulnar portal is safer than the radial on the fourth finger (P=.042), while the radial is safer than the ulnar on the fifth finger (P=.003). CONCLUSIONS: The third finger was the safest to perform metacarpophalangeal portals, while the ulnar side of the second finger and radial side of the fourth had the highest risk of nerve injury.

Background Nowadays, the wrist is not limited to a dorsal visualization; the joint can be thought of as a "box," which can be visualized from almost every perspective. The purpose of this study was to describe a new volar central portal for the wrist, following three principles: a single incision that allows access to both the radiocarpal and midcarpal joints, centered on the lunate, with the volar structures at risk protected not only by retractors, but also by tendons. Description of Technique The incision begins in the distal wrist crease and extended 1.5 cm proximally up to the proximal wrist crease, following the axis of the third intermetacarpal space. The flexor superficialis tendons are identified and retracted toward the radial side. Next, the fourth and fifth flexor digitorum profundus tendons are retracted toward the ulnar side, while the third and second tendons are retracted toward the radial side. The volar central midcarpal portal is performed under direct vision just over the anterior horn of the lunate through the Poirier space. The volar central radiocarpal portal is created under the lunate through the interval between the ulnocarpal ligaments and the short radioulnar ligament. Methods An anatomical study was performed on 14 cadaver specimens. Two data were recorded: iatrogenic injuries of the structures at risk and the distances to the structures at risk. Results The median (interquartile range [IQR]) distances from the volar central radiocarpal portal to the median nerve, palmar cutaneous branch of the median nerve, and ulnar neurovascular bundle were 10.5 (7.8-15.0), 18.5 (15.8-20.3), and 7.0 (5.0-10.5) mm, respectively. The median (IQR) distances from the volar central midcarpal portal to the median nerve, palmar cutaneous branch of the median nerve, and ulnar neurovascular bundle were 7.0 (4.8-10.3), 16.0 (14.8-19.0), and 4.5 (3.8-9.0) mm, respectively. No iatrogenic injuries were observed. Conclusion The volar central portal is reproducible and safe. The risk of iatrogenic injury is low. The capsule is pierced through one of its thinner portions, and both the radiocarpal and midcarpal joints can be inspected through one single incision.

OBJECTIVES: Clinical and functional outcome of the knee after Unicompartmental Knee Arthroplasty (UKA) and its correlation with lower limb mechanical axis correction. MATERIAL AND METHODS: We have reviewed the outcome of 29 UKA, corresponding to 29 patients, with an average follow-up of 4.5 years (3-6 years). The distribution was, 21 women and 8 men, 11 unicompartmental osteoarthritis, 17 femoral condyle necrosis and 1 tibial plateau necrosis, and 27 medial versus 2 lateral affected compartments. The clinical-functional situation of the knees was assessed through the Knee Society Score (KSS), and the mechanical axis through long standing film. To calculate the statistical non-parametric correlation between the different parameters, Spearman's coefficient was used. RESULTS: In the last review, the increases in the mean clinical KSS and functional KSS were significantly different, with +31.24 (±15.7) and +43.66 (±18.4) points, respectively. The mean change in the femorotibial angle was 2°±4°. We did not find any correlation with statistical significance between the average increases obtained in KS scores and: the alignment of the knee before and after the surgery; the thickness of the inserted polyethylene; the variation of the posterior tibial inclination; Insall-Salvati's index. There was no statistically significant association between the variation in the total KS score and the type of implant or the surgical technique used. CONCLUSION: We did not find any correlation between the clinical results and the radiological measurements in this population.

We present an anatomical study and description of a new surgical technique for arthroscopic treatment of scapholunate ligament injuries. Five cadaver specimens were used to perform the technique. After arthroscopic surgery, anatomic dissection was performed to measure the distances to critical wrist structures such as the posterior interosseous nerve and the radial artery, and the size and position of the plasty. This arthroscopic technique offers three advantages: soft tissue damage is reduced (avoiding an extensive approach and injury to the secondary stabilizers and reducing scar tissue); injury to the posterior interosseous nerve is avoided (maintaining wrist proprioception and the role of the dynamic stabilizers); and a biotenodesis is made that ensures proper placement, tension and functionality of the flexor carpi radialis ligament reconstruction.

Topical tacrolimus is an immunosuppressant that acts through the inhibition of calcineurin and thus of the T cells. This causes a decrease in the production of interleukins, the granulocyte colony stimulating factor, alpha interferon and tumor necrosis factor. Although the use of topical tacrolimus is only indicated for the treatment of moderate or severe atopic dermatitis, its immunosuppressant effect and fewer side effects regarding topical corticosteroids have lead to the increase of its use in other types of inflammatory skin diseases. The purpose of this article is to review the use of tacrolimus in this group of diseases other than atopic dermatitis, this use not being authorized within the data sheet of the drug.

Cutaneous extramedullary hematopoiesis is a rare manifestation of chronic myeloproliferative processes, mainly chronic idiopathic myelofibrosis. In adults, it manifests as macules, papules, nodules, and ulcers on the trunk. The lesions usually appear soon after diagnosis and the possibility of a relationship between splenectomy and the appearance of extramedullary foci of hematopoiesis is still debated. Diagnosis is based on histopathology showing an infiltrate with different combinations of myeloid and erythroid cell precursors and megakaryocytes. Symptomatic treatment is provided alongside treatment of the underlying disease. We report a new case associated with chronic idiopathic myelofibrosis in which foci of cutaneous extramedullary hematopoiesis were observed 9 years after initial diagnosis. The lesions were progressive and the patient went on to develop acute myeloid leukemia.
